Rookery Hove Treatment and care programmes

  • Individual care pathways tailored to each patients needs
  • Intensive programmes lasting between 18 months and five years
  • Planned outcome of transition into more independent setting
  • Individual social, personal and educational development programmes
  • Therapy programmes
  • Strategies to assist with anxieties
  • Support in work and college placements
  • Preparation for employment or higher education
  • Opportunities to integrate into community life
  • 52 week provision

The service includes comprehensive educational packages accredited through a number of national organisations and opportunities for residents to study at local colleges and/or undertake work-based learning where appropriate.

At Rookery Hove we provide intensive social, personal and educational development programmes. Our highly trained staff team gives specialist support and develops strategies to help individuals overcome the challenges they face.

Each resident has a key worker to act as mentor and carer offering support to residents while at Rookery Hove. Key workers are responsible for monitoring social and personal development programmes to ensure that individual potential is being met.

Rookery Hove provides 24 hour specialist care and support, 52 weeks a year. Provision will usually be on a relatively short-term basis of less than five years although this may be extended depending on individual need. Each resident will have an individual social and educational development programme created in partnership with them and their support team to ensure their needs and ambitions are being met.
